Shipping Intelligence.

Arrivals. Sept. 15. Elizabeth and Henry, barque, 535 tons. Clarke master, from Newcastle, with cattle, horses, &c. Passengers, Mr. Maxwell and Mr. Carr. J. S. Polack, Agent. Sept. 16. Clara, barque, 860 torn, Crow, matter, ham. London, with general cargo. Passengers. Mies E, Shillibeer, Mr. Bell, Mr». Bell, Miss Bell. Mr. J. Bell, Mr. E. Bell and wo.boys, Mr. Alitford, Lieut. Hutchinson, Mr. Gould, Mr. K. Bell, Dr. and Mrs. Carter, Mr. Wall, wife and four children. Mr. and Mrs. Hall, Mr. R. Hall, two Miss Halls, and a boy, Mr. Walker. Brow n & Campbell, agent. Sept. 17. Star of China, schooner, 101 tone, Dowker, matter, from N«w Plymouth, with flour, potatoes, wheat, &c. Passengers Mr. Aubrey, Mr. Hurst' home, Mr. Caodish, and Mr. aud Mrs. Andrews* Master, agent. Sept. 18. Sir John Franklin, schooner, 52 tons, Lilewall, master, from Feegeee, with Cocoa oat oit, Tortoise shell, &c. Passengers, Captain Walden, Mr* Ssuager, Mr* Gwynne, Mr. Garden, Mr. fckey, sad 7in steetage. R. A* FitzGerald, agent. , Departures. Sept schooner, 62 tons, Bowdeo, master, for Hobart Town via Hawke's Bay, there to load with oit. bone, &c. Passengers, Mr. J. S. Macfurlane. Captain Salmon, agent.
